Finance Review Summary — Board Distribution

The Brightmoor pilot programme recorded customer churn of 6.2% over the measurement window, above the 4% threshold set at launch. Exit interviews attribute most departures to onboarding friction rather than price. Corrective actions — a revised setup flow and a dedicated success contact — were introduced midway, after which monthly churn improved measurably. Finance recommends extending the pilot one further quarter before a scale decision. Context relevant to that recommendation follows below.

management briefing: The pricing group signed off on a budget of $378.8 million for Project Kasael.

// GiftLeaf receipt mailer: send-window constant.
// Receipts for the Mosswood Foundation queue must go out within
// RECEIPT_SLA_MINUTES of a confirmed donation, or the batch job
// flags them late and pages the duty rota. Do not raise this
// without sign-off from the stewardship lead — downstream tax
// summaries assume the same window. Contractors: test changes
// against the sandbox ledger only. The value was last validated
// in the build identified by the token below.

pipeline stamp: htk6_35e0c9

### ENV-4417: staging hot-reload picking up wrong credential

The Copperjay config watcher hot-reloads `.env.staging` on change, but someone left a stale duplicate key at the bottom, and last-write-wins meant the reloader kept applying the dead one. I've deleted the duplicate. Reviewer: please confirm the file now ends with the single correct entry:

secret setting of tawif-tajop: COURIER_KEY13=819c65d82d2bd

= Document Transport: Print Shop Master Copies =

Master copies for Longreach Print Works are dispatched from the warehouse every second Monday. Masters travel flat in the rigid portfolio cases, never folded or rolled, with a packing slip inside and a duplicate slip taped to the lid. Cases are stored in the keyed rack near bay two until collection. Only Penhallow Express drivers may take these cases. Before releasing a case, the shift lead confirms the driver's run sheet.

handover note for tadug-yaguf: the aldath pelwyn courier leaves the casox norwyn briix silok zorok kasdor aldion quenox ledger at gate 2653 under passcode 959015